Statistical Data Analysis Graduate Certificate


Department: Dean’s Office
 

 
There is a significant need to certify professional statistical analysts in various fields, such as the social, medical, physical, and biological sciences, engineering, business, and other industries. Individuals who have their baccalaureate or graduate degrees from these fields, and who find it necessary to design experiments, collect and analyze data, and interpret and make decisions based on ordinary and complex statistical techniques and methods would benefit from this certificate. This interdisciplinary Graduate Certificate in Statiistical Data Analysis fulfills the basic educational training required to address these professional activities.
